Understanding Internet Speed: Download, Upload, and Ping Explained
Author: Adam Noah
Published: February 2026
Reading Time: 8 minutes
Category: Internet Fundamentals
Introduction
In today's digital world, internet speed has become as essential as electricity. Whether you're streaming your favorite show, working from home, or playing online games, your internet connection's performance directly impacts your experience. However, many people don't fully understand what internet speed actually means or how to interpret the numbers they see on speed test results.
When you run an internet speed test, you're presented with three main metrics: download speed, upload speed, and ping. These numbers can seem confusing at first, but understanding them is crucial for diagnosing connection problems, choosing the right internet plan, and optimizing your network performance. This comprehensive guide will demystify these metrics and explain how they affect your daily internet usage.
What is Internet Speed?
Internet speed refers to how quickly data travels between your device and the internet. It's measured in megabits per second (Mbps), where one megabit equals one million bits of data. Think of it like a water pipe: a larger pipe allows more water to flow through simultaneously, just as higher internet speeds allow more data to transfer at once.
However, internet speed is not a single number. Instead, it consists of multiple components that work together to determine your overall internet experience. Understanding each component helps you identify why your connection might feel slow and what you can do about it.
Download Speed: The Most Important Metric
Download speed measures how quickly data travels from the internet to your device. This is the metric most people focus on because it affects the majority of internet activities. When you stream a video, load a website, or download a file, you're using your download speed.
How Download Speed Affects Your Activities
The required download speed varies significantly depending on what you're doing online. For basic web browsing and email, you might only need 5-10 Mbps. However, streaming high-definition video on Netflix or YouTube typically requires 5-25 Mbps depending on the quality. If you're streaming 4K content, you'll need at least 25 Mbps, and some services recommend 50 Mbps or higher for smooth playback without buffering.
Video conferencing applications like Zoom or Microsoft Teams require moderate speeds, typically around 2.5-4 Mbps for high-quality video calls. Online gaming is less demanding than you might think—most games only need 5-10 Mbps for smooth gameplay. However, the consistency of your connection matters more than raw speed for gaming.
Why Download Speed Matters More Than Upload Speed
In most internet usage scenarios, you download far more data than you upload. When you watch a video, the entire video file travels from the server to your device. When you browse a website, all the images, text, and multimedia content download to your browser. This is why internet service providers (ISPs) typically offer much higher download speeds than upload speeds—they're optimized for the most common use case.
Upload Speed: Often Overlooked but Important
Upload speed measures how quickly data travels from your device to the internet. While it's typically much lower than download speed, upload speed has become increasingly important as more people work remotely and use cloud-based services.
When Upload Speed Matters
If you simply browse the web and stream videos, you might never notice your upload speed. However, if you work from home and participate in video conferences, upload speed becomes critical. Video conferencing requires consistent upload speeds of at least 2.5-4 Mbps for good quality. If you're the one presenting or sharing your screen, you might need even higher speeds.
Content creators, including streamers, YouTubers, and podcasters, need significant upload speeds. Uploading a one-hour video to YouTube can take hours with slow upload speeds. A 1 GB video file with a 1 Mbps upload speed would take approximately 2.3 hours to upload. With a 10 Mbps upload speed, the same file uploads in about 14 minutes. This is why content creators often upgrade to fiber internet, which offers symmetrical speeds (equal download and upload speeds).
Cloud backup services also benefit from faster upload speeds. If you use services like Google Drive, Dropbox, or iCloud to back up your files, faster upload speeds mean your backups complete more quickly. This is especially important if you work with large files or have significant amounts of data to back up regularly.
Ping: The Hidden Factor Affecting Your Experience
Ping, measured in milliseconds (ms), represents the time it takes for data to travel from your device to a server and back. While download and upload speeds determine how much data you can transfer, ping determines how quickly your device communicates with servers. Think of ping as the reaction time of your internet connection.
Understanding Latency
Ping is also called latency, and these terms are used interchangeably. A lower ping is always better. For most internet activities, a ping under 100 ms is acceptable. However, for activities requiring real-time interaction, lower ping is crucial.
How Ping Affects Different Activities
For web browsing and streaming, ping has minimal impact as long as it's under 100 ms. You won't notice the difference between a 20 ms ping and an 80 ms ping when watching a video or reading a website.
Online gaming is where ping becomes critical. Professional gamers often aim for ping under 50 ms, and competitive players want ping under 20 ms. With a ping of 100 ms or higher, you'll experience noticeable lag where your actions feel delayed. In fast-paced games, this delay can mean the difference between winning and losing.
Video conferencing is another area where ping matters. High ping can cause delays in conversations, making communication feel awkward and unnatural. Most video conferencing applications work acceptably with ping up to 150 ms, but below 50 ms is ideal.
Jitter: The Consistency Factor
Related to ping is jitter, which measures the variation in ping over time. If your ping fluctuates wildly between 10 ms and 100 ms, you have high jitter. Even if your average ping is low, high jitter can cause problems with real-time applications like gaming and video conferencing.
Jitter is measured in milliseconds, and lower is better. For most activities, jitter under 30 ms is acceptable. For gaming and video conferencing, jitter under 10 ms is ideal. High jitter causes stuttering, lag spikes, and connection instability that can be more annoying than consistently high ping.
How These Metrics Work Together
Understanding how download speed, upload speed, ping, and jitter work together is essential for diagnosing connection problems. A fast download speed doesn't help if you have high ping and jitter. Similarly, low ping is useless if your download speed is too slow for your activity.
Consider a gamer with 100 Mbps download speed, 10 Mbps upload speed, 150 ms ping, and 50 ms jitter. While the speed is excellent, the high ping and jitter will cause noticeable lag during gameplay. Conversely, a gamer with 10 Mbps download speed, 5 Mbps upload speed, 20 ms ping, and 2 ms jitter will have a smooth gaming experience despite the lower speeds.
Factors That Affect Your Internet Speed
Several factors can affect the speeds you actually experience, even if your ISP provides higher speeds. Understanding these factors helps you optimize your connection and troubleshoot problems.
Distance from the server: Data travels at the speed of light through fiber optic cables, but the physical distance to the server affects latency. Connecting to a server on the other side of the world will have higher ping than connecting to a local server.
Network congestion: During peak hours when many people are using the internet, speeds can decrease. This is especially true on shared networks like WiFi in apartment buildings or public WiFi networks.
WiFi vs. wired connection: WiFi is convenient but slower and less stable than a wired Ethernet connection. WiFi speeds are affected by distance from the router, obstacles, and interference from other devices.
Router quality: An older or low-quality router might not deliver the speeds your ISP provides. Upgrading to a modern router can significantly improve your WiFi performance.
Device capability: Your device must support the speeds your connection provides. Older devices might have slower network adapters that limit speeds.
Conclusion
Internet speed is more than just a single number. Download speed, upload speed, ping, and jitter all work together to determine your overall internet experience. By understanding these metrics, you can better diagnose connection problems, choose an appropriate internet plan, and optimize your network for your specific needs. Whether you're a casual web browser or a competitive gamer, knowing what these numbers mean empowers you to make informed decisions about your internet connection.
The next time you run a speed test, you'll understand exactly what each metric means and how it affects your online activities. If you're experiencing slow internet, you'll know which metric to focus on improving. And if you're shopping for a new internet plan, you'll be able to choose one that truly meets your needs rather than just picking the highest number.
